Transaction c840a414565ddcf245d29cf814de386d39b274423163ffabb45bcbf24bb914fe

6 Input
2 Outputs
  • c840a414565ddcf245d29cf814de386d39b274423163ffabb45bcbf24bb914fe:0
  • value  5245144
    address  19aEDKhsRLEeegVXCqtPWEyV8YoSHWGyfY
  • c840a414565ddcf245d29cf814de386d39b274423163ffabb45bcbf24bb914fe:1
  • value  25741375
    address  36c3oxTNSdeC8v4S8A1rzxJ2B4jiEeNabH